
In addition to D319, this patch updates the parameter editor, the UI of Freestyle. Using new API functionality and experience gained in making D319, this patch provides a quite noticable speedup for commonly-used Freestyle linestyle modifiers. As this patch touches a lot of code (and mainly the foundations) it is likely that mistakes are made. The patch has been tested with a regression suite for Freestyle (https://github.com/folkertdev/freestyle-regression-tests/tree/master), but testing with scenes used in production is very much appreciated.
